Applications Across Industries
Radio transmitters are used in multiple sectors:
-
Broadcasting & Media: Signal broadcasting devices enable reliable transmission of television, radio, and streaming content to large audiences.
-
Industrial & Manufacturing: Industrial radio devices facilitate wireless communication between machines, sensors, and control systems, optimizing factory automation and operational efficiency.
-
Consumer Electronics: IoT transmission systems in smart TVs, smart home devices, and wearables rely heavily on high-performance radio transmitters.
-
Defense & Aviation: Wireless communication devices are critical for mission-critical operations, ensuring uninterrupted connectivity in remote or challenging environments.
The convergence of smart consumer electronics and industrial applications is expected to further drive the adoption of radio transmitters worldwide.
